The global bicycle market is not static; it is constantly evolving. Identifying emerging markets is crucial for exporters looking to expand their reach and increase sales.
As urbanization continues to rise in developing countries, more consumers are looking for sustainable transportation options, making these markets ideal for bicycle exports. Understanding the demographics and preferences of these consumers is essential.
Regions such as Southeast Asia and Latin America are showing significant potential for bicycle sales. Analyzing regional trends can help exporters tailor their offerings to meet local needs.
Entering new markets requires a keen understanding of local regulations regarding product standards, tariffs, and import restrictions. Familiarizing yourself with these regulations can prevent costly setbacks.
Logistics can be a significant hurdle in emerging markets. Building relationships with local logistics companies can streamline the shipping and distribution process.
The rise of e-commerce has opened new avenues for reaching customers in emerging markets. Utilizing online sales channels can enhance visibility and accessibility for your products.
Crafting targeted marketing strategies that resonate with local cultures and preferences is vital for success. Consider collaborating with local influencers and engaging in community-focused initiatives.
Emerging markets offer exciting prospects for bicycle exports. By conducting thorough research and adopting strategic approaches, exporters can successfully navigate these new territories and drive their business growth.
